#D50196 Color
#D50196 is rgb(213, 1, 150) in RGB, hsl(318, 99%, 42%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 100%, 30%, 16%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Frostbite (#E936A7),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.84.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#D50196 Channel Values
How #D50196 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 213 · G 1 · B 150 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 318° · S 99% · L 42%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 318° · S 100% · V 84%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 100% · Y 30% · K 16%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.91:1 vs white · 4.27: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#D50196 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#D50196 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#D50196?
#D50196 is a mid-tone pink — rgb(213, 1, 150) in RGB and hsl(318, 99%, 42%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Frostbite (#E936A7),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.84.
What is the RGB value of #D50196?
#D50196 is rgb(213, 1, 150) — red 213, green 1, and blue 150 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#D50196?
#D50196 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 100%, 30%, 16%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#D50196 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#D50196 scores 4.91:1 against white and 4.27: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#D50196 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#D50196 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umvioletred (#C71585) at a CIE76 distance of 9.09,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
